### Inside the Al's Food Town Weekly Ad: Top Deals and Favorites
The Al’s Food Town weekly circular focuses heavily on high-velocity grocery staples, with a primary emphasis on the "Meat Market" and "Fresh Produce" sections. Shoppers consistently find the deepest markdowns on bulk meat packages, particularly family-pack USDA Choice ground chuck, bone-in pork chops, and whole frying chickens. These items are frequently featured as "loss leaders" to drive foot traffic.
Beyond proteins, the weekly ad prioritizes seasonal produce, offering aggressive price points on regional staples like vine-ripened tomatoes, sweet corn, and citrus fruits. Household goods and dry grocery items—such as canned vegetables, pasta sauces, and baking supplies—are often grouped into "Buy One, Get One" (BOGO) or "10 for $10" promotional structures. Regular customers primarily anticipate the "Weekend Flash Sales" highlighted in the ad, which often feature deep discounts on name-brand sodas, snack chips, and frozen pizzas, which are staples for local shoppers planning weekend gatherings.

About Al's Food Town
Al’s Food Town is a regional independent grocery retailer operating primarily in the Houston, Texas metropolitan area. Functioning as a full-service supermarket, the chain focuses on providing a traditional grocery experience with an emphasis on competitively priced produce, meat, and pantry staples.
Their product range includes standard grocery offerings, featuring dedicated meat counters, fresh produce departments, and a selection of international and ethnic food products tailored to the diverse demographics of their local neighborhoods.
The brand’s unique selling point is its community-centric model; Al’s Food Town differentiates itself by operating in urban and suburban locations where they act as a primary food provider, often emphasizing value-oriented pricing and localized inventory that reflects the specific cultural preferences of the communities they serve.
Where Does Al's Food Town Operate?
Al's Food Town operates in the Houston metropolitan area, with locations serving the neighborhoods of Heights, West University, and Bellaire.
